Uasin Gishu County Assembly Leader of Majority Josephat Lowoi has called for the suspension of Devolution Cabinet Secretary Anne Waiguru over the alleged mismanagement of public resources and corruption that has hit her ministry.

Speaking at the county assembly on Tuesday, Lowoi said it is time for Waiguru to be shown the door before the ministry is declared bankrupt.

"It is time that the President (Uhuru Kenyatta) listens to Kenyans and sends CS for Devolution Ann Waiguru home. Why is she being spared and yet her ministry leads in corruption or how special is she? She should be shown the door," he claimed.

The majority leader wondered how money be overspend under her watch where a fine ball pen costs Sh8, 700 and she still keeps mum.

"The President has really let down Kenyans by allowing corrupt officers to work in his government despite promising to fight it to letter. He has done nothing but just giving empty promises. Waiguru should be investigated," he said.

He said if Uhuru wants to win Kenyans’ trust, he should fight corruption within his government and if not, in 2017, he will not have Kenyans’ support since the cost of living has skyrocketed due to graft bedeviling his government.

Lowoi’s remarks come after the Principal Secretary Peter Mangiti on Tuesday “accidentally” revealed to the Parliamentary Accounts Committee the misappropriation of funds that has hit Waiguru’s ministry.
